Kirk's Dad is the God of Thunder

Movie news on Thor the movie.
The actor that played Kirk's dad in Star Trek (George Kirk) has been cast as Thor in Kenneth Branagh's movie. I'm glad they cast a somewhat unknown but Chris Hemsworth (pictured above) is gonna have to seriously bulk up.
Tom Hiddleston has been cast as the trickster god, Loki.
This comes out summer 2011. If they do this right; it should be incredibly awesome.

Where art Thor?

After Matthew Vaughn (Stardust) has delayed beginning to direct Thor due to his filming of a new comic book adaptation of Kick-Ass. So we have a new director and it's very surprising:
Kenneth Branagh
The famed Shakespearean actor and director who has directed such non-Shakespearean movies such as Dead Again and Frankenstein and his last film was the financial failure As You Like It of the famed Shakespearean comedy.
The Thor script is written by by Mark Protosevich, screenwriter for the recent Will Smith hit I Am Legend. Marvel describes it as their Lord of the Rings and the plan is for Thor to be in Marvel's future team movie, The Avengers.
